ConvertKit to WooCommerce Use Cases

1

Sync ConvertKit subscribers to WooCommerce customers

When a subscriber is created or updated in ConvertKit, the corresponding customer record in WooCommerce is automatically created or updated. Contact details, company associations, and custom fields are all mapped.

2

Automated error handling and retry for ConvertKit/WooCommerce sync

When a sync between ConvertKit and WooCommerce fails due to a rate limit, network issue, or validation error, the integration retries automatically with exponential backoff. Your team is alerted only when intervention is genuinely needed.

Data Mapping

How data flows between ConvertKit and WooCommerce

ConvertKitWooCommerceNotes
ConvertKit Subscribers -> idWooCommerce Customers -> idUnique identifier stored as cross-reference for record linking
ConvertKit Subscribers -> email_addressWooCommerce Customers -> emailPrimary matching key for identifying existing records across both platforms
ConvertKit Subscribers -> first_nameWooCommerce Customers -> firstNameContact identity fields synchronised to maintain consistency
ConvertKit Subscribers -> tagsWooCommerce Customers -> tagsClassification data merged and deduplicated across both systems
ConvertKit Owner/AssigneeWooCommerce Owner/AssigneeRecord ownership mapped between platforms using email address as the matching key
ConvertKit Record IDsWooCommerce External ReferencesCross-reference identifiers stored on both records for bidirectional lookups and deduplication
ConvertKit TimestampsWooCommerce Audit LogCreated and modified timestamps preserved for sync conflict resolution and compliance
ConvertKit FormsWooCommerce Custom FieldsForms data from ConvertKit stored in WooCommerce custom fields for reference
ConvertKit SequencesWooCommerce Custom FieldsSequences data from ConvertKit stored in WooCommerce custom fields for reference
ConvertKit TagsWooCommerce Custom FieldsTags data from ConvertKit stored in WooCommerce custom fields for reference
